In collaboration with a-space in Switzerland, PAPER presents Into the Deep Woods. Drawing inspiration from the interpretation of the forest as the unconscious, 10 artists and a poet have responded to this notion, creating within their works a narrative construct to explore the theory of the forest as a psychological space. The forest signifies the realm of the imagination, which, according to Lacan, is the psychic place, or phase, where the child projects its ideas of self in order to develop its own identity, sexuality, and gendered self. A recurrent theme in fairytales is the protagonist entering the forest. Through the ensuing narrative and their chilling encounters, they inevitably gain a sense of the changes in their lives, particularly from child to adult, and also a sense of morality.
